SAN DIEGO, CA, April 28, 2011 (Press-News.org) Limelight Public Relations, a full service lifestyle PR agency with offices throughout the West Coast, announced today seven clients signed on in Q1 of 2011. From the action sports, film and music industries; to hospitality and festivals, the clients are a reflection of Limelight's expertise in producing high-impact media campaigns in a variety of industries.
In the agency's sports and entertainment division, Maloof Skateboarding has tapped Limelight for the third consecutive year to manage all public relations initiatives for Maloof Skateboarding and the Maloof Money Cup. The scope of work includes managing PR for the national and international skateboarding contests, with a 2011 tour that spans from New York and Washington, D.C. to Southern California and South Africa.
The San Diego Film Festival has also renewed its relationship with Limelight for its 10th anniversary run, marking a partnership that started with the festival's inception. Limelight will continue to manage on-site media, film publicity and celebrity appearances for the Sept. 28-Oct. 2 event.
Limelight is pleased to welcome new digital music client ReDigi, the world's first online marketplace to legally buy and sell used music. Limelight will manage the national media campaign for the site's public launch this summer. ReDigi will be managed by Limelight's Orange County team.
In the agency's nonprofit division, Feeding America San Diego (FASD) also signed with Limelight after the agency successfully managed the organization's "Every Little Bottom" Huggies diaper drive in December. Limelight now manages the nonprofit's media relations, special events and social media. FASD is San Diego's largest distributer of donated food, with a goal to provide 16 million pounds of food to deserving families and schools each year.
Back for the second year with Limelight is the annual Beer and Sake Festival, a fundraiser for the Japan Society of San Diego and Tijuana's education programs. Limelight also extends its ongoing relationship with San Diego Professionals Against Cancer, managing public relations for its 17th Annual San Diego Festival of Beer returning to downtown San Diego Sept. 9. As the oldest beer festival in San Diego, the event features more than 50 craft breweries and 100 percent of the proceeds benefit San Diego cancer charities. The festivals will be managed by Limelight's San Diego team.
Adding to Limelight's extensive hospitality and food and beverage practice, the Los Angeles office will manage all media relations, social media and events for Excalibur Knights Place, a medieval restaurant set to open this summer near Staples Center in downtown Los Angeles. This is the first U.S. location for Excalibur, which is currently based in Europe.

Business Review Australia takes a look at TransGrid. Following the disaggregation of the New South Wales Electricity Commission (trading as Pacific Power), TransGrid was formed as a statutory authority in 1995, under NSW Electricity Transmission Authority Act of 1994. TransGrid became corporatised in 1998 under NSW State Owned Corporations Act of 1989. Now, the state-owned corporation owns and manages one of the largest high-voltage electricity transmission networks in Australia, connecting generators, distributors and major end users in NSW and the ACT.
